Solution

The correct option is C Assertion is correct, but Reason is incorrect
For 1st order reaction,
at=a0ekt
given that at=(10.63)a0=0.37a0
0.37=ekt
kt=1 or k=1t
Also, k=AeEaRT
rate constant does not depend on initial concentration of reactants.
